Output 52598cdce00c4849b87530e1778bcea238359881d27968e0c5e432a0e9d0e22a:1

value
37760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6105251bc28dacdebf315700a3795e3fc6a9c39b OP_EQUAL
address
A1HGNUWDgdqQQtNxHdehLcfkGnrGj54W1Y
transaction
52598cdce00c4849b87530e1778bcea238359881d27968e0c5e432a0e9d0e22a